Nabs wrote: Fri Oct 24, 2025 5:37 am Thanks to Beatle for offering me the chance to try his new system in preview. I really appreciate its simplicity, and it seems very promising. I'm starting my learning process, and here's my first closed trade on crude oil:

1. Crossover of the Currency Strength Wizard lines.
2. TMA and blue sub-window indicator.
3. Waiting for a seller excess bar in the CSW (see the screenshot) then i enter i the next buyer bar.

For the targets, I displayed the Fibonacci lines from CSW, which are very relevant for visualizing the day's objectives.

Millionaire Maker is a standalone trading system. It is not necessary, but always a very good habit to check the higher time frames for bias. ;) Because a BUY or SELL on a lower time frame could just be a small pullback on a higher time frame. Knowing this, you can anticipate that the move on the lower time frame may not be substantial.

But, DO NOT become paralysed by constantly wanting to check multiple charts, higher time frames and waiting for signals on different time frames to align. ;)

Get in, ride it to the max, Get out.

The system has been designed so that you can maximise the move you take on whatever time frame you trade. I am a swing trader, so I trade both 30-minute and 1-hour time frames.

BeatlemaniaSA wrote: Thu Oct 23, 2025 9:39 pm Yeah, I love the CSW. I love how it presents the information. Yes, the lines recalculate, but that actually works in our favour.

This is how it does that. When the lines initially cross, it is a signal for you to pay attention. Then, as the price action progresses, it gradually starts to deviate from each other, confirming the trend change. However, since we are only entering initially on the bottom sub-window signal (non-repaint) by the time we get the initial entry signal, the lines have already separated, confirming the trend. So no stressing. Also, we can use the combination of the entry signal below and the CSW lines crossing as an exit signal (and entry signal).

If we get the TMA crossing as well, even better! There are special case scenarios that I will be explaining as well,
